#56fae1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#56fae1 is composed of 33.7% red, 98%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 10%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 170.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 65.9%. #56fae1 color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#00f5c3.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#56fae1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000202 is the darkest color, while #eefff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#56fae1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6aaa9 is the less saturated color, while #56fae1 is the most saturated one.
